  10. I had the same problem. The retaining clips had broken away. The solution i used was to wrap a cable tie around the outer case of the maf, a cable tie around the hose leading into the maf and then a final tie which threaded between the two and pulled tight. No more gap. Hope this helps if the clips are broken.
